A 21-year-old construction worker died after a section of the concrete lining collapsed inside the Silkyara-Barkot tunnel in Uttarkashi

July 16, 2026: A 21-year-old construction worker from Jharkhand was killed after a section of the concrete lining inside the Silkyara-Barkot tunnel collapsed in Uttarkashi district during the early hours of Thursday. According to District Magistrate Prashant Arya, the incident occurred around 2 a.m., nearly 900 metres from the Barkot side of the 4.5-km-long tunnel, when a heavy portion of the tunnel’s concrete shotcrete lining fractured and fell on the worker.

Officials said the worker suffered fatal injuries after being struck by the debris and died at the spot. The administration confirmed that no other workers were trapped in the collapse and that the tunnel remained accessible. Senior district officials have been directed to inspect the site and submit a detailed report on the incident.

The National Highways and Infrastructure Development Corporation Limited (NHIDCL) has launched an investigation to determine the cause of the structural failure. The Silkyara tunnel had previously drawn global attention in November 2023, when a major collapse trapped 41 workers inside for 17 days before they were rescued in a complex multi-agency operation involving specialised rat-hole miners.
